1. Choose a Licensed UK Casino
Before making any transactions, make sure the casino is licensed by the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C). This ensures the site follows strict rules about fairness, data protection, and player security.

You can usually find the licensing information in the footer of the website. If it’s not clearly listed, it’s best to move on to a different site.

2. Set Up Your Account Properly
To deposit or withdraw money, you’ll need to create a verified account. This means:

Using your real name and contact details.

Verifying your identity with documents (passport, driver’s licence, utility bill, etc.).

Linking a secure payment method in your name.

This step is important for your safety and helps prevent fraud or misuse of your funds.

3. Choose Secure Payment Methods
Stick to trusted, secure payment options that offer encryption and fraud protection. Some of the safest methods for UK players include:

Debit Cards (Visa, Mastercard): Widely accepted and familiar.

PayPal: Fast, secure, and adds an extra layer of protection.

Skrill and Neteller: Trusted e-wallets known for quick and safe transfers.

Bank Transfer: Good for larger withdrawals, though may take longer.

Pay by Mobile or Prepaid Cards: Limit spending and keep your bank details private.

Always check if the casino charges fees for using specific payment methods.

4. How to Deposit Safely
Depositing money is usually instant and straightforward. Follow these steps:

Log in to your casino account.

Go to the Cashier or Deposit section.

Choose your preferred payment method.

Enter the amount you want to deposit.

Follow the prompts to complete the payment (e.g., entering card details or confirming via PayPal).

Make sure the site uses SSL encryption (you’ll see a padlock in the browser bar) to keep your financial information secure.

5. Withdrawing Your Winnings
When you’re ready to cash out:

Visit the Withdrawal section of your account.

Select the payment method (often must be the same one used for deposit).

Enter the withdrawal amount.

Submit the request.

Some casinos may take a few hours to a couple of days to process your request. E-wallets are typically the fastest, while bank withdrawals can take 2–5 working days.

6. Watch for Common Pitfalls
To keep things running smoothly, avoid these common issues:

Unverified accounts: If you haven’t verified your ID, your withdrawal could be delayed.

Wagering requirements: If you’ve accepted a bonus, make sure you’ve met all terms before withdrawing.

Using someone else’s payment method: Always use payment options registered in your own name.

7. Keep Records and Stay Informed
Keep track of your deposits and withdrawals so you can spot any issues early. It’s also helpful to regularly check your bank or e-wallet statements.

If something doesn’t seem right or you have a dispute, you can contact:

The casino’s support team (most offer live chat or email).

The UK Gambling Commission for licensed operator concerns.

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R) services like eCOGRA if needed.
